随着比特币和其他加密货币的流行,数字货币的安全性问题受到了越来越多用户的关注。比特币钱包作为存储和管理比特币的重要工具,其安全性直接影响到用户的资产安全。而离线签名作为保护私钥和交易的有效手段,得到了广泛的应用和关注。本文将深入探讨如何使用手机比特币钱包进行离线签名,以及相关的实践技巧和注意事项。
什么是比特币钱包及其功能
比特币钱包是用于存储比特币和管理比特币交易的软件。它的主要功能包括生成和管理地址、存储私钥、发送和接收比特币、查看交易历史等。比特币钱包可以分为在线钱包、桌面钱包和移动钱包(手机钱包)。
手机钱包因其便利性和便携性而备受用户青睐,尤其是在日常交易中。用户可以随时随地使用手机钱包进行比特币的收发,省去了使用电脑的麻烦。然而,便捷性同时也带来了安全隐患,特别是在联网状态下,私钥有被攻击的风险。
离线签名的概念与原理
离线签名是确保比特币交易安全的一种方法,其基本原理是用户在连接互联网的设备上生成交易信息和签名,但私钥永远不会与互联网连接。这种方式可以有效防止私钥被黑客窃取。
具体过程为:用户在离线状态下生成交易信息,然后使用本地存储的私钥进行签名,再将签名后的交易信息传输到联网的设备进行广播。通过这种方式,用户能够确保自己的私钥不被暴露,增加了比特币存储的安全性。
手机比特币钱包的离线签名步骤
使用手机比特币钱包进行离线签名,用户可以按照以下步骤操作:
1. **选择合适的比特币钱包**:首先,用户需要选择支持离线签名功能的手机比特币钱包。目前许多知名钱包都支持此功能,如Electrum和Coinomi等。
2. **创建或导入钱包**:在选择好钱包后,用户需要创建新的钱包或导入已经存在的钱包。在这个过程中,务必按照提示备份好助记词和私钥。
3. **生成交易信息**:在钱包中选择“发送”功能,输入接收地址和发送的金额,然后保存生成的交易信息。此时,保持手机处于离线状态。
4. **签名交易**:利用离线手机钱包的签名功能,输入私钥生成签名。在这个过程中,私钥不会被泄露,只是在本地环境下进行操作。
5. **导出签名后的交易信息**:将签名后的交易信息导出,可以使用二维码、文本文件等形式传输。当然,用户需确保在这一过程中不将任何敏感信息通过未加密的方式传输。
6. **广播交易**:将签名后的交易信息导入到联网的设备中,使用在线钱包或比特币节点进行交易广播。至此,整个离线签名过程结束。
安全性考虑与最佳实践
尽管离线签名提高了比特币交易的安全性,但用户仍需遵循一些最佳实践以确保私钥和交易信息的安全:
1. **使用硬件钱包**:如果条件允许,使用硬件钱包来生成和管理私钥是最佳选择。硬件钱包专为安全存储而设计,具有强大的抗攻击能力。
2. **定期备份**:无论是在手机钱包还是硬件钱包,定期备份助记词和私钥。这可以在丢失或损坏设备的情况下恢复钱包。
3. **保持软件更新**:确保使用的比特币钱包保持更新,以获得最新的安全补丁和功能改进。
4. **防范钓鱼攻击**:警惕任何要求输入私钥或助记词的情况,务必确认操作网站或应用程序的真实性。
常见问题解答
1. 离线签名与在线签名有什么区别?
离线签名与在线签名的主要区别在于私钥的管理方式。在在线签名中,私钥可能会暴露在联网的环境中,易受攻击。而在离线签名中,私钥始终处于非联网状态,增强了安全性。
通过比较离线签名和在线签名的优缺点,我们可以更清晰地理解二者:
- **优点**:离线签名可以有效防止黑客窃取私钥,并无须担心恶意软件的影响。在线签名相对简易,但风险更高,特别是在公共Wi-Fi环境下。
- **缺点**:离线签名操作相对复杂,需求用户对交易信息的生成和处理有一定了解;而在线签名则便于快速交易,但安全性较低。
因此,对比特币用户而言,根据其具体需求和技术水平,选择最适合的签名方式至关重要。
2. 手机钱包的安全性如何保障?
保障手机钱包安全性可以从多个方面入手,主要方式包括:
1. **使用强密码和双因素身份验证(2FA)**:很多手机钱包支持设置强密码及启用2FA,增加盗取成功的难度。
2. **软件加密与备份**:手机钱包内的私钥和助记词应加密存储,并定期备份到安全的地方。使用安全云存储或加密USB保存备份是个不错的选择。
3. **及时更新应用程序**:及时更新手机钱包的应用程序,以确保获得最新的安全补丁和功能改进。
4. **避免在公共网络下交易**:尽量避免在公共Wi-Fi网络下进行交易,使用VPN也可以提供额外保护。
通过上述措施,用户可以显著提升手机钱包的安全性,降低资产风险。
3. 离线签名是不是适合所有用户?
离线签名确实有着突出的安全优势,但并非所有用户都适合使用这一方式。以下是适合和不适合使用离线签名的用户特质:
适合使用离线签名的用户往往具备一定的技术背景,能够独立操作比特币交易,并理解如何安全管理私钥。而且,频繁进行大额交易或长期持有比特币的用户,出于安全考虑也非常适合使用离线签名。
相对而言,对于新手用户或频繁小额交易的用户,离线签名可能带来不必要的复杂性。在这种情况下,使用便捷的在线钱包或手机钱包即能满足日常需求,且操作简单。
4. 如何从手机钱包迁移到离线签名机制?
将手机钱包迁移到离线签名机制需要用户进行一系列步骤,包括选择合适的钱包、创建离线环境、备份私钥等。这一过程总结如下:
1. **选择兼容离线签名的钱包**:如前所述,用户可选择支持离线签名功能的Wallet进行操作。
2. **创建安全的离线环境**:用户需准备一台处于离线状态的电脑,确保其不连接到互联网,使用防火墙设置进一步增强安全性。
3. **导出私钥**并在离线环境中进行管理,务必确保私钥的脱机安全,尽量减少暴露风险。
4. **保持操作习惯**,逐渐熟悉离线签名的过程,建立起安全、高效的比特币管理体验。
综上所述,离线签名作为一项安全保障措施,正日益受到比特币用户的重视。通过理解其机制,安全操作流程,以及相关的最佳实践,用户可以在保障个人资产的同时,享受数字货币带来的便利与自由。